Superconducting YBa 2 Cu 3 O 7-δ thin films were prepared on SrTiO 3 (100) planes at 560°C by rf multitarget magnetron sputtering without postannealing. The films were composed of two differently oriented grains with the c or a axis perpendicular to the surface. The preferential orientation could be controlled by the preparation condition. The transition to a superconducting state started at 90 K and zero resistance was achieved at 80 K for the films.
